About "Playing chess against your own shadow"

by Jan Keteleer

About the artwork

This painting, "Playing chess against your own shadow," is a profound exploration of the inner complexities of human nature. At its center, a man engages in a tense chess match against his own shadow, both players using only black pieces. This choice of color embodies the intrinsic duality of good and evil that resides within us all.
The man represents our conscious, strategic side, while his shadow stands for the subconscious and instinctual parts of our psyche. The strategic placement of two windows allows sunlight to cascade through from opposite directions, bathing the room in a mystical glow. This light serves as a metaphor for enlightenment, truth, and clarity—a guiding force in our perpetual quest for self-awareness.
The room's atmosphere is steeped in mystery, inviting viewers to pause and reflect on their own internal battles. The interplay of light and shadow creates an ethereal setting that transports onlookers into a realm of introspection. The painting evokes a sense of intrigue, urging us to ponder our own choices and the dichotomies that define our existence.
In this visual narrative, every observer is called to witness the universal truth of our internal conflicts, appreciating the beauty and complexity of the human spirit, even amidst its shadows.
